Mozambique escudos were replaced with the metical in 1980. Mozambique redenominated the metical on July 1, 2006 at a rate of 1000:1. At these exchange rates one hundred Mozambique escudos would be equivalent to 0.32 cents in the USA today. The bank note itself could be worth around 20 US dollars to sell.
